Dragon Battles Multiplayer begins with the selection of a dragon and immediate entry into a 3D arena where the primary objective is to survive against both human-controlled opponents and ground-based AI characters. As a new player, your first run involves mastering the transition between ground movement and flight. You start by navigating the terrain using standard directional inputs, but the real tactical depth emerges once you take to the skies. The environment is populated by other dragons and hostile units that will fire upon you from the ground, requiring constant movement and spatial awareness to avoid taking damage.
Combat is divided between ranged and melee engagements. You can utilize fireballs for precision strikes or engage in close-quarters combat with melee attacks when you are in proximity to an opponent. For more devastating area-of-effect damage, the fire breath ability allows you to sweep across targets, though it requires careful positioning. Managing your movement is just as important as your offensive output. You have access to a sprint for closing distances and a dodge mechanic to evade incoming projectiles, which is essential when multiple enemies target you simultaneously.
Navigation and communication are handled through a dedicated interface. A map is available to help you locate threats and allies across the 3D world, while a chat system allows for coordination with other players in the session. The game emphasizes the scale of these aerial battles, encouraging you to use the verticality of the map to your advantage. Whether you are diving from high altitudes to surprise a ground target or engaging in a high-speed chase with another dragon, the focus remains on maintaining your health while neutralizing threats.
Each session is a standalone experience where the goal is to dominate the current match. There are no persistent upgrades or long-term progression systems to manage, ensuring that every player starts on equal footing. Success depends entirely on your ability to manage your dragon's flight path, aim your fireballs accurately, and time your dodges to survive the chaotic crossfire of a multiplayer battleground.

How to Play
To begin your journey in Dragon Battles Multiplayer, use the WASD or arrow keys to navigate your dragon across the terrain. Your first priority is to understand the flight mechanics. Press Space to ascend into the air and use the C key to lower your altitude. Mastering the transition between ground and sky is vital for both attacking and evading enemies.
Combat involves three primary methods of attack. Use the Left Mouse Click to launch fireballs at distant targets. For close-range encounters, the Right Mouse Click performs a melee strike. If you find yourself facing a group of enemies, hold Shift and Left Click to unleash a powerful fire breath. Remember to manage your movement during these attacks; use L Shift to sprint and R to dodge incoming fire from ground units or other dragons.
Keep an eye on your surroundings by pressing M to view the map, which helps you track the positions of other players. If you need to coordinate or talk to others, press T to open the chat. If you need to take a break or adjust your view, the Esc or Tab keys will bring up the pause menu.

Tips & Tricks
- Use the dodge key frequently to avoid ground-based projectiles
- Combine sprinting with flight to quickly close the gap on distant enemies
- Monitor the map to avoid being flanked by multiple dragons
- Switch to fire breath when enemies are clustered together for maximum impact
